Зачем MODIFIER_PROPERTY_MOVESPEED_MAX и MODIFIER_PROPERTY_MOVESPEED_LIMIT

DDSuper

Друзья CG
31 Май 2019
405
57
Ну зачем эти проперти когда они даже в луа не работают.
Есть какое решение?

Обычно пишу так

Код:
modifier_max_speed_lua = class({})

function modifier_max_speed_lua:DeclareFunctions()
    local funcs = {
        MODIFIER_PROPERTY_MOVESPEED_MAX,
        MODIFIER_PROPERTY_MOVESPEED_LIMIT,
    }

    return funcs
end

function modifier_max_speed_lua:GetModifierMoveSpeed_Max( params )
    return 1000
end

function modifier_max_speed_lua:GetModifierMoveSpeed_Limit( params )
    return 1000
end

function modifier_max_speed_lua:IsHidden()
    return true
end
 
  • Нравится
Реакции: SniperX
20 Дек 2016
892
170
Не работают, забей. Если хочешь убрать лимит в 550 скорости, используй MODIFIER_PROPERTY_IGNORE_MOVESPEED_LIMIT , GetModifierIgnoreMovespeedLimit (вернуть любое число, отличное от нуля)
 
  • Нравится
Реакции: SniperX и DDSuper
Реклама: